Jim Ratcliffe’s Ineos Car Venture Cuts ‘Several Hundred’ Staff

Nov. 13, 2025, 2:44 PM UTC

Ineos Automotive Ltd., the car business launched by UK billionaire industrialist Jim Ratcliffe, is cutting “several hundred” jobs as the loss-making venture grapples with higher US tariffs.

The reduction in headcount will affect office staff across multiple locations to boost efficiency, the company said in a statement Thursday. Ineos Automotive said it will now focus on its core manufacturing and commercial activities.
